15f5b19d by Gabriele Svelto at 2023-05-08T11:20:18+02:00
Bug 1784018 - Remove deprecated OSSpinLocks r=glandium

On macOS versions prior to 10.15 os_unfair_locks cannot spin in kernel-space
which degrades performance significantly. To obviate for this we spin in
user-space like OSSpinLock does, for the same number of times and invoking
x86-specific pause instructions in-between the locking attempts to avoid
starving a thread that might be running on the same physical core.

Bug 12885: Windows Jump Lists fail for Tor Browser

Jumplist entries are stored in a binary file in:
  %APPDATA%\\Microsoft\Windows\Recent\CustomDestinations\
and has a name in the form
  [a-f0-9]+.customDestinations-ms

The hex at the front is unique per app, and is ultimately derived from
something called the 'App User Model ID' (AUMID) via some unknown
hashing method. The AUMID is provided as a key when programmatically
creating, updating, and deleting a jumplist. The default behaviour in
firefox is for the installer to define an AUMID for an app, and save it
in the registry so that the jumplist data can be removed by the
uninstaller.

However, the Tor Browser does not set this (or any other) regkey during
installation, so this codepath fails and the app's AUMID is left
undefined. As a result the app's AUMID ends up being defined by
windows, but unknowable by Tor Browser. This unknown AUMID is used to
create and modify the jumplist, but the delete API requires that we
provide the app's AUMID explicitly. Since we don't know what the AUMID
is (since the expected regkey where it is normally stored does not
exist) jumplist deletion will fail and we will leave behind a mostly
empty customDestinations-ms file. The name of the file is derived from
the binary path, so an enterprising person could reverse engineer how
that hex name is calculated, and generate the name for Tor Browser's
default Desktop installation path to determine whether a person had
used Tor Browser in the past.

The 'taskbar.grouping.useprofile' option that is enabled by this patch
works around this AUMID problem by having firefox.exe create it's own
AUMID based on the profile path (rather than looking for a regkey). This
way, if a user goes in and enables and disables jumplist entries, the
backing store is properly deleted.

Unfortunately, all windows users currently have this file lurking in
the above mentioned directory and this patch will not remove it since it
was created with an unknown AUMID. However, another patch could be
written which goes to that directory and deletes any item containing the
'Tor Browser' string.  See bug 28996.

7223704f by Pier Angelo Vendrame at 2023-05-08T12:19:37+02:00
Bug 9173: Change the default Firefox profile directory to be relative.

This commit makes Firefox look for the default profile directory in a
directory relative to the binary path.
The directory can be specified through the --with-relative-data-dir.
This is relative to the same directory as the firefox main binary for
Linux and Windows.

On macOS, we remove Contents/MacOS from it.
Or, in other words, the directory is relative to the application
bundle.

This behavior can be overriden at runtime, by placing a file called
system-install adjacent to the firefox main binary (also on macOS).

2dd8088f by Igor Oliveira at 2023-05-08T12:19:38+02:00
Bug 23104: Add a default line height compensation

Many fonts have issues with their vertical metrics. they
are used to influence the height of ascenders and depth
of descenders. Gecko uses it to calculate the line height
(font height + ascender + descender), however because of
that idiosyncratic behavior across multiple operating
systems, it can be used to identify the user's OS.

The solution proposed in the patch uses a default factor
to be multiplied with the font size, simulating the concept
of ascender and descender. This way all operating
systems will have the same line height only and only if the
frame is outside the chrome.

5cba8e22 by Kathy Brade at 2023-05-08T12:35:34+02:00
Bug 13379: Allow using NSS to sign and verify MAR signatures

Allow using NSS on all platforms for checking MAR signatures (instead
  of using OS-native APIs, the default on Mac OS and Windows).
  So that the NSS and NSPR libraries the updater depends on can be
  found at runtime, we add the firefox directory to the shared library
  search path on macOS.
  On Linux, rpath is used to solve that problem, but that approach
  won't work on macOS because the updater executable is copied during
  the update process to a location that can vary.
